6-2-5  Initializing and Saving the Error Log 
This function initializes the macro error history saved in the PT or saves the history in the 
Memory Card. 
Up to 100 errors can be recorded in the error log. The number of errors that can be recorded, 
however, also depends on the free space in the memory. 
The error log records the errors that occur when the macro function is executed. Initialize or 
save the error history by using operations from the Initialize Tab Page in the System Menu, as 
follows:  
Initializing the Error Log 
1. Press the Initialize Button.  
A confirmation message will be displayed. Press the Yes Button to initialize the data. Press the 
No Button to cancel the initialize function.  
 
 
 
 
2.  When the PT has completed initializing the error log, a dialog box will be displayed indicating 
that the error log has finished being initialized.  
 
 
 
 
Saving the Error Log 
1. Press the Save Button. The Save Button will be lit yellow while data is being saved. 
2.  When the PT has completed saving the error log, the Save Button will return to its normal 
color. 
A dialog box will be displayed indicating that the save has been finished. 
 
 
Reference
  •  The error log is deleted when project data or system programs are downloaded. 
  •  The error log can also be initialized by turning ON $SB42 in system memory from the 
host, and can be saved by turning ON $SB43 in system memory from the host. Refer 
to 2-4 System Memory in the PT Programming Manual for details.
